The Paydens Group of Pharmacies is an award-winning family business and was founded in 1969 with one pharmacy in a small country village. We have since grown to 115 pharmacies in Kent, Sussex, London, Essex and Surrey..

Responsibilities & Duties

·       To provide safe, effective and efficient pharmacy services;

·       To ensure compliance with relevant NHS contractual provisions, relevant legislation and GPhC            standards of conduct, ethics and performance;

·       To ensure that NHS services are tailored to local needs;

·       To build and maintain strong relationships with customers, GP Surgeries and other healthcare              professionals;

·       Overall management and responsibility of the branch and staff;

·       Checking and providing clinical services such as NMS and MUR;

·       Providing professional services within the branch;

·       To provide a high level of customer service through effective management of staff, services and          stock; and

·       Maximise sales and minimise waste through effective stock management and merchandising

·       To lead, manage and motivate pharmacy staff and to develop the training of colleagues

·       Accountable for legal and ethical decisions

Qualifications

The successful candidate must hold an MPharm degree or equivalent. You will be required to have your GPHC registration upon your start date. You will also be NMS and MUR accredited and are, or willing, to undertake the training necessary to become qualified in any advance or enhanced services that the company may deem necessary to maximise the revenue for the pharmacy.
